How to find your meeting details on the mobile app?
Find your meeting details such as time, table number, and location on the app. Go to the Brella App > Messages > select and open chat > see details if the meeting was accepted.
To open the map, click on the three dots (...) on the right side of the details and select "show map". If there is no map, check if there is one in the "Event Info" section.
If you don't have a table number assigned, arrange your custom location with your meeting partner through chat or a virtual meeting.
💡Note! Only if your meeting is accepted can you see the meeting details on the chat, like the table number, the time, and the date. The table will be located in the networking area.

How to meet my match if there is no networking area or table number at the event?
If there is no networking area or table number, the organizer gives you the option to arrange your location with your match through the chat.
Suggest a location at the venue OR opt for the virtual meeting (video call) to meet up with your meeting partner. (If the virtual meeting option is available)

Check the event map in the Event Info section
💻On the Web app:
Check whether the map is in the Event Info section. To go there, go to next.brella.io, then go to the Home Page and scroll down till you see an "Event Info" card click on "Floorplan" or "Floor Map."
Sometimes the map is also added as a tab on the side panel. Click on "Floorplan" or "Floor Map" on the lower-left side panel of the screen.
📱On the Mobile app:
Check whether the map is in the Event Info section. To go there, go to the Brella app Home page, then click on the "Event Info" button. In here, you can see the list of essential guidelines and documents for you to have during the event, including a venue/floor map.
Sometimes the map is also added as a tab on the side panel.
⚡ Note: If there is no virtual map, don't worry, as the organizer will mark the networking area at the event venue. Watch for the signs! And if you have any issues, you can contact your event organizer.
